Stadium
The is an indoor arena located in , which was built for the XII Pan American Games in 1995. It is qualified to host such sports as basketball, handball, volleyball and tennis, as well as to accommodate any type of show, convention and exhibition. is situated 1½ km southwest of Abuelo tito.
